解析JSON数据时,如果数据中有双引号,可以用转义符\来表示。具体方法可以根据使用的编程语言或工具的不同而不同。以下是解析JSON数据中双引号的一些常用方法:
在大多数编程语言中,JSON解析器自动处理转义字符,并正确解析带双引号的数据。你只需要调用相应的JSON解析函数或者方法。如果手动解析JSON数据,可以使用字符串处理函数来处理转义字符。例如,在Python中,可以使用replace方法将“替换为”。导入json
json_data = '{"key ":"带\\ "双引号\\""} '的值
parsed _ data = JSON . loads(JSON _ data . replace(' \ \ " ','"'))
print(parsed _ data)# { ' key ':' value with " double quotes " ' }如果使用命令行工具来解析JSON数据,可以在引号前加一个反斜杠\来转义它们。$ echo '{"key ":"带\ "双引号\""} '的值| jq。
{
" key ":"带\ "双引号\ "的值"
无论哪种方式,都可以正确解析JSON数据中的双引号。
以上内容来自互联网,不代表本站全部观点!欢迎关注我们:zhujipindao。com
评论前必须登录!
注册